This study aimed to examine the differences in mathematics retention of grade V Primary school between students who were taught using guided discovery learning model and inquiry learning model. The method in this study was a quasy experimnetal method. The population in this study was all students in grade V at SDN Pongangan and SDN Sukomulyo in 2018/2019 academic year which in total were 202 students. Samples were selected by purposive random sampling. The sample was divided into two group which are experiment 1 and experiment 2. The instrument used to collect mathematics retention data was a written test. The Data was analysed using descriptive statistic analysis and t-test. The results of data analysis at 0,05 significance level and df = 130 showed that t-count (2,276) > t-tabel (1,978) and also p-value (2-tailed) 0,024 < 0,05. So, it mean that there was a significant difference in mathematics retention between students who were taught using guided discovery learning model and inquiry learning model.

The purpose of this study was to know the significant different in science knowledge between the group of students who were taught through Guided Inquiry Learning Model assissted by concrete media and the group of students who were taught through conventional learning model at grade IV students of SD Gugus Dewi Sartika Denpasar Timur in academic year 2017/2018.  The population of this research was all fourth grade students of SD Gugus Dewi Sartika Denpasar Timur in academic year 2017/2018. The sampling was conducted by random sampling technique by randomizing class. The sample of this research was IV B of SD N 10 as experimental group and IV B of SD N 3 Kesiman as control group with the total number of experimental group was 40 students and the contol group was 41 students. The data collected was the data of the competency of science knowledge and analyzed by t-test. After being analyzed by t-test, obtained tcount = 2,372 at significance level 5% ( = 0,05) with dk = 79 and ttable (a = 0,05) = 2.000. Based on the test value tcount = 2.372 > ttable (a = 0,05) = 2.000. The results showed that experimental gained more score in compared to control group with mean of = 0,41> = 0,31, it can be concluded that there is an effect by implementing Guided Inquiry Learning Model toward science knowledge competence. Thus, there is a significant difference between the science knowledge of the group which were taught through Guided Inquiry Learning Model assissted by Concrete Media and the group of students who were taught through conventional learning in IV grade students of SD Gugus Dewi Sartika East Denpasar in academic year 2017/2018.

This study aims "To determine whether there is influence of discovery learning model assisted problem card in a straight motion on the results of study X science class SMA Negeri 1 Mranggen academic year 2014/2015". The population in this study were all class X  SMAN 1 Mranggen Academic Year 2014/2015. Sampling using cluster random sampling technique with the normal condition of all classes and homogeneous. Sampling results obtained by X-class science experiment 1 as a class were treated when learning takes place using discovery learning model and problem cards for class X IPA 2 as the control class is given learning using discuss learning group. Based on the final analysis of the t-test showed that t = 4.6738 while the table = 1.671 with a significance level of 5%. Because thitung > ttable is 4.6738> 1.671 it can be interpreted that the average student learning outcomes experimental class better than the class control. The average value of the experimental class is 77.6316 and 70.6579 as control class. Pursuant to the results of this study concluded that there are significant of discovery learning model assisted problem card in a straight motion on the results of study X science class SMA Negeri 1 Mranggen academic year 2014/2015.

This study aims to determine the effect of the student team achievement division (STAD) learning model in improving the science learning achievement of class XI students of SLB E Bhina Putera Surakarta Indonesia in the 2020/2021 academic year. This research is an experimental research that uses a one group pretest-posttest design. The subjects in this study were 5 emotional and social disorders children in class XI at SLB E Bhina Putera Surakarta in the 2020/2021 academic year which were determined using the saturated sampling technique. The research instrument used a written test in the form of multiple choice totaling 25 questions. The results of this study were analyzed by using the Wilcoxon Sign Rank Test. Based on the data analysis that has been conducted, it found that the Zcount value = -2.060 with Asymp.Sig. (2-tailed) of 0.039 which is at the significance level (p < 0.05). Based on the results that have been obtained, it shows that the student team achievement division (STAD) learning model has an effect on increasing the science learning achievement of class XI students with SLB E Bhina Putera Surakarta in the 2020/2021 academic year.

The aim of this research applied a quasi-experiment by factorial design 2x3 which was conducted to the student of MAN 1 Mataram is to find out the influence of guided discovery learning model combined with experiment method and VAK style due to physics learning outcomes. The population is the students from grade X MIA in MAN 1 Mataram. The sampling technique is using purposive sampling, where, grade X of MIA 1 as an experiment class and grade X of MIA 2 as a control. Data for learning outcomes are measured by applying multiple choice test while learning style of students using a questionnaire — the hypothesis test using ANAVA test of two ways supported by SPSS 16 with 5% significance level. According to the analysis results, it can be concluded that: 1) there is an effect of guided discovery learning model with experimental method toward physics learning outcome of students because of sig. <0,05;  2) there is no effect of VAK learning style on physics learning result in MAN students because sig.>0,05; 3) there is no interaction between guided discovery learning model with experiment and VAK learning style method of physics learning result in MAN student because of sig.>0,05.

The purpose of this research were to know: (1) the effect of REACT learning model on the students’ understanding of mathematical concepts, (2) the effect of guided discovery learning model on students' understanding of mathematical concepts, (3) the difference in students’ mathematical concept understanding obtained by using REACT learning model and guided discovery learning. This research type was quasi experiment with entire class VII MTs Al-Islam Joresan as population and class VIIA and VIIB as sample. Class VIIA was taught  by using the REACT learning model and class VIIB was taught by using the guided discovery learning model. The instrument used was a question sheet of concept comprehension test and data collection the technique was test and documentation. The concept comprehension test results were analyzed using t test with significance level of 0.05. The results of the hypothesis test showed that the REACT learning model has an effect on the students’ understanding of mathematical concepts. In addition, the guided discovery learning model has an effect on the students’ understanding of mathematical concepts. Both REACT learning model and guided discovery learning model showed no difference in students’ mathematical concept understanding.

This study aims to determine the relationship between the assessment of students’ learning processes that use the Guided Inquiry Learning and Guided Discovery Learning learning models for formative outcomes. This research uses a quantitative approach with correlation analysis between two research variables. Data on the assessment of student learning processes is obtained from the evaluation given during the learning process, which is at the conclusion stage of each meeting. Student formative learning outcomes data were obtained from diagnostic test questions in the form of reasoned multiple-choice questions and descriptions at the end of chemical equilibrium learning. The results showed the relationship between the assessment of learning processes with student learning outcomes classified as High with a correlation coefficient of 0.81 for class XI Science 1 with Guided Discovery learning model and 0.86 for class XI Science 4 with Guided Inquiry learning learning model.

The purpose of this study is to improve the activities and learning outcomes of science in the material special features of living things through the application of the Discovery Learning model of class VI MIN 8 students in Southwest Aceh 2018/2019 Academic Year. The learning model used in this study is the Discovery Learning model. The subjects of this classroom action research were students in class VI MIN 8 Aceh Barat Daya. The number of students is 27 students with 15 male students and 12 female students. This research was conducted in the 2018/2019 school year within a period of 3 months, from August to October 2018 in odd semester. The methodology of this research is classroom action research consisting of two cycles and each cycle consists of two meetings. Each cycle consists of planning, implementing, observing and reflecting. The research procedure consisted of pre-research, planning cycle one, implementing cycle one, observing cycle one, reflection cycle one, planning cycle two, implementing cycle action two, observing cycle two and reflection cycle two. Data collection techniques are collecting test scores that are carried out at the end of each learning cycle in each cycle using the written test instrument. Learning outcomes data were analyzed by means of percentage descriptive statistics. The results showed that (1) Student learning activities increased from the good enough category and the good category increased to very good (2) The completeness of student learning outcomes from 33.33% pre cycle increased to 59.25% in the first cycle and in the second cycle increased to 85.18 %. The application of the Discovery Learning model has been able to improve the activities and learning outcomes of natural science students on the material of the special characteristics of living creatures of class VI MIN 8 students in Southwest Aceh 2018/2019 Academic Year.

The objective of this study is to find out whether Mind Mapping is effective or not in improving students’ ability in writing tourism brochures at SMA 20 Batam. This study is limited on writing tourism brochure for tenth grade students at SMA Negeri 20 Batam in Academic year 2017/2018. The study was designed by the writer by using true experimental design (pre-test and post-test control group). The population of the study were tenth grade students of SMA Negeri 20 Batam academic year 2017/2018. There were eight classes of tenth grade students with the total number 300 students. The samples of this study were two classes which consist of 30 students in experiment class and 30 students in control class. The instrument of this study was written test. The data analysis was used Independent Samples Test on IBM SPSS statistics 20 to perform T-test. The result showed that the Sig.(2-tailed) of students’ pre-test and post-test in experimental was 0.401 and standard significance level was 0.05. By comparing the Sig.(2-tailed) and standard  significance level, it was known that Sig.(2-tailed) was bigger than standard significance level (0.401 > 0.05). It means there was no significant difference in writing tourism brochure before and after taught by using Mind Mapping in experimental class. Therefore, the alternative hypothesis (Ha) was rejected and the null hypothesis (Ho) was accepted. The conclusion of Mind Mapping was not given significant effect in improving students’ ability in writing tourism brochure.
